“Merry Christmas!” Angela told Chris as she opened the door to welcome him into her home. Justin, Joey, and Lance were already there. The only person that was missing was the person most important to her. JC.

Angela sighed as she showed Chris to the living room and new that this would be the first Christmas that she and JC hadn’t spent together since they started going out. It wasn’t JC’s fault though. He had to stay behind in LA to get some work done. He would’ve said no, but none of the others wanted to do it so he did it as a favor to Johnny.

“The tree looks fantastic,” Justin complimented.

“Thanks. I just got it done about an hour before everyone showed up,” Angela replied.

The five of them laughed and carried on until almost midnight. It would’ve carried on for much longer too until Angela interrupted the fun and told everyone they should go home. If it was up to the four men they would’ve stayed, but she didn’t give them that option.

“Go on, guys. I’m fine. You guys go home and go to bed. Joey, you’ll really need it since Brianna will be up early.”

“Are you sure?” Lance asked.

“Positive. I’ll see you guys later. Thanks for coming,” Angela assured. A few more words were exchanged before she was finally left alone.

She sighed heavily and went back out into the living room to sit in front of the Christmas tree she had spent two hours to decorate while listening to Christmas songs like “Silent Night”. As much as she tried she couldn’t stop thinking about JC.

“I wish you were here. That’s the only gift I want for Christmas.” She closed her eyes and imagined JC was curled up on the couch with her enjoying their time together. It wasn’t long before she fell asleep.

JC unlocked the door as quietly as he could and set his suitcases by the door. He quietly walked through the house until he reached the living room where he found what he had taken a plane, two buses, and three taxies for.

He knew that if he got his work done as fast as he could and did whatever means necessary to get home, that he might make it in time for Christmas. He looked down at his watched and a smile broke out across his face. He made it. It was two in the morning. Christmas morning to be exact.

He walked over to Angela and looked down at her for a moment before he kissed her softly on the lips. Angela slowly woke up. Her eyes lit up as soon as she saw JC.

“JC?” she asked. She had to know that she wasn’t dreaming.

“Yeah, baby, it’s me. I’m home.”

That was all Angela needed to know. She jumped off the couch and into JC’s open arms. They hugged fiercely never wanting to let go of each other. After five minutes, they finally pulled away from each other.

“How did you get here? I thought you weren’t going to be home until tomorrow?” Angela asked.

“I knew I couldn’t let you be alone on Christmas, so I got done with work early in hopes I could make it here in time for Christmas,” JC explained.

“You made it and I’m glad. You’re the only thing I wanted for Christmas.”

“Me too, Angie.”

“Well what do you want to do now that you’re home?” Angela asked.

“Kiss the woman I love,” JC replied and pointed above their heads. Angela looked up and a smile broke out across her face. There was mistletoe above them.

JC brought her head down and kissed her. Angela melted into the kiss knowing that this wouldn’t be a Christmas she would forget.

“I love you,” JC murmured against her lips.

“I love you too.”
